Controls and Dependencies to Confirm
The proposal should distinguish application controls from operating controls. Issues such as credential ownership, signature validation, duplicate callbacks, time-outs, refunds or reversals, provider downtime and changes to an external API may cross that boundary. Clear responsibility and escalation notes are more credible than a guarantee that no error or disruption can occur.
Inputs That Shape the Scope
Before confirming modules, the customer should assemble provider documentation, merchant or account approval, sandbox credentials, callback rules, status mapping and reconciliation reports. Reviewing these items together reveals missing decisions and conflicting terminology. It also prevents a visual mock-up from being mistaken for a complete operational specification.
